Your housing selection is irrelevant until you actually select dorm rooms in May. Your roomie will have a better time slot than you so heāll āpullā you up with him.
Modular dorms are popular and going in as a pair is harder than going in single to find an open room. Definitely have a shot but know your back up choices ahead of time. The selection process is super quick and rooms disappear in the blink of an eye
The only reason they ask for dorm choices is to gauge interest. It holds no value til the end.
